SUMMARY: The Maintenance Planning Manager will be responsible for the proper planning of all plant maintenance programs. This is to include the writing of maintenance procedures, creating & maintaining preventative maintenance long text in EAM, assigning specific functions to include repairs and PM coverage to mechanics and technicians, coordinating parts receiving for work to be performed, as well as tracking safety and maintenance training.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include, but are not limited to, the following:
  • Planning and management of major maintenance work such as fabrication, modification, and installation of new and existing equipment, cost improvements and modernization projects
  • Schedules planned maintenance to ensure that equipment, parts, and systems are operating efficiently; partners with maintenance and refrigeration management on equipment, parts and systems that need replacement.
  • Manages unplanned maintenance requests and delegate appropriate resources to fulfill maintenance orders.
  • Create efficiencies in both the planning and execution of maintenance functions, improving reliability, safety and reducing waste.
  • Creating and maintaining a master preventative maintenance schedule to ensure that daily maintenance tasks and goals are met timely and accurately.
  • Ensure repairs to machinery and facilities by mechanics are done in a manner that protects both the TM and complies with company policy & government regulations.
  • Establish, maintain, and track record keeping requirements within the Maintenance departments, i.e., downtime and equipment history; provide reports to leadership on maintenance activities.
  • Perform project and other duties as assigned.
